The Science Behind Cold Air Intakes

To understand why a cold air intake is helpful, one must understand standard combustion physics. Internal combustion engines require three things to operate: fuel, spark, and oxygen. The cooler the air is, the denser it becomes. Thick air includes more oxygen particles per cubic foot, enabling the engine's computer to inject more fuel, leading to a more effective explosion within the cylinders.

Factory intake systems often pull air from the warm engine bay through narrow, ribbed plastic tubing that creates turbulence. An aftermarket CAI uses smooth, mandrel-bent pipes and positions the filter in a position to draw cooler air from outside the engine compartment or through a heat-shielded box.

Tools and Preparation

Among the main appeals of the Dodge Ram 1500 cold air intake setup is that it is a "bolt-on" adjustment. This implies it needs no drilling or long-term adjustment to the vehicle, and the majority of installations can be completed in under an hour using basic hand tools.

Needed Equipment List

  • Socket Set: 8mm, 10mm, and 13mm sockets are standard for a lot of Ram models.
  • Ratchet and Extension: To reach deeper bolts near the fender.
  • Screwdrivers: Both Phillips and Flathead for tube clamps and sensing unit removal.
  • Pliers: To release factory spring clamps on breather tubes.
  • Microfiber Cloth: To clean internal surfaces before assembly.
  • Sensor Cleaning Spray (Optional): Highly suggested for cleaning up the Intake Air Temperature (IAT) sensor.

Step-by-Step Installation Guide

While particular brands (such as K&N, S&B, or aFe Power) may have small variations in their hardware, the basic treatment for the Dodge Ram 1500 stays constant throughout a lot of model years.

Action 1: Safety First and Battery Disconnect

Before any mechanical work begins, make sure the vehicle is parked on a level surface with the emergency situation brake engaged. Disconnect the unfavorable booster cable utilizing a 10mm wrench. This prevents any electrical shorts and, more significantly, requires the Engine Control Unit (ECU) to reset its fuel trim information, allowing it to "discover" the new air flow parameters upon restart.

Step 2: Removing the Factory Air Box and Tube

  1. Disconnect the Sensors: Locate the Intake Air Temperature (IAT) sensor on the side of the factory intake tube. Carefully depress the locking tab and pull the connector away.
  2. Loosen Hose Clamps: Use a flathead screwdriver or an 8mm socket to loosen the clamps at the throttle body and the air box.
  3. Remove Breather Hoses: There is normally a crankcase vent hose pipe connected to the back of the air box or tube. Usage pliers to move the clamp back and pull the pipe totally free.
  4. Extract the Unit: Most Ram 1500 air boxes are held in location by rubber grommets. Firmly pull the entire box assembly upward to pop it out of its installing tray.

Step 3: Transferring the IAT Sensor

The IAT sensor should be transferred from the old tube to the new intake tube. It is generally kept in location by a basic "twist and lock" mechanism.

  • Keep in mind: Handle this sensing unit with severe care. Do not touch the bulb at the end. If the sensor appears filthy, use a dedicated Mass Air Flow (MAF) or IAT sensor cleaner before installing it into the new tube's rubber grommet.

Step 4: Assembling the New Intake System

Before heading to the engine bay, it is typically much easier to put together the new heat guard and filter housing on a workbench.

  1. Connect any weather removing to the top edge of the heat guard to ensure a tight seal versus the hood.
  2. Install the mounting brackets onto the brand-new air box.
  3. Insert the intake tube into the air box or heat shield based on the maker's instructions, ensuring the filter mount is accessible.

Step 5: Installing the New Unit

  1. Location the Air Box: Seat the new intake housing into the factory grommet locations. Bolt down any supplied brackets to the car frame.
  2. Link to Throttle Body: Slide the silicone coupler onto the throttle body and then place the intake tube. Do not tighten the clamps fully up until television is completely lined up.
  3. Attach Breather Hoses: Connect the crankcase vent tube to the new port on the intake tube.
  4. Set up the Filter: Slide the high-flow air filter onto completion of the tube inside the air box. Tighten the clamp till it is snug.

Action 6: Final Connections and Testing

  1. Plug the IAT sensing unit harness back into the sensing unit.
  2. Go through the whole assembly and tighten up all tube clamps and bolts. Make sure there is no "play" or rubbing versus other engine parts.
  3. Reconnect the unfavorable battery terminal.

Long-Term Maintenance

Unlike factory paper filters that are discarded every 10,000 to 15,000 miles, most cold air intake filters are "life time" parts.

  • Oiled Filters: Require cleaning and re-oiling every 25,000 to 50,000 miles, depending upon driving conditions.
  • Dry Filters: Generally only require a fast vacuum or a specialized cleaning solution every 20,000 miles.

Often Asked Questions (FAQ)

1. Will installing a cold air intake void my Ram 1500's warranty?

No. Under the Magnuson-Moss Warranty Act, a dealership can not void your whole lorry warranty just because an aftermarket part was set up. They should prove that the particular aftermarket part triggered a failure to reject a service warranty claim.

2. Is a "Tune" needed after installation?

For a standard cold air intake on a Ram 1500, a custom ECU tune is not required. The truck's factory computer can change for the increased air flow. Nevertheless, a tune might assist make the most of the performance gains of the intake.

3. Will I actually see much better gas mileage?

In theory, yes. Due to the fact that the engine is drawing air more efficiently, it spends less energy "breathing." However, lots of chauffeurs find their MPG drops at first because they enjoy hearing the brand-new engine noise and speed up more aggressively.

5. Inspect Engine Light (CEL)-- Why did it come on?

If a CEL appears after setup, it is generally due to a loose sensor connection, an air leakage past the sensing unit, or the sensing unit being installed backwards. Double-check all clamps and guarantee the IAT sensor is seated correctly.
